Match List - I with List - II.
Choose the correct answer from the options given below :
| List I (Compound) | List II (Use) |
|---|---|
| (A) Carbon tetrachloride | (I) Paint remover |
| (B) Methylene chloride | (II) Refrigerators and air conditioners |
| (C) DDT | (III) Fire extinguisher |
| (D) Freons | (IV) Non Biodegradable insecticide |

Match each compound with its common use
(A) Carbon tetrachloride
- Carbon tetrachloride was historically used in fire extinguishers.
- So, .
(B) Methylene chloride
- Methylene chloride () is commonly used as a paint remover.
- So, .
(C) DDT
- DDT is a non-biodegradable insecticide.
- So, .
(D) Freons
- Freons are used in refrigerators and air conditioners as refrigerants.
